Reciprocal Space Investigation Tools
The APEX2 suite offers a number of tools for a detailed analysis, using a set of diffraction images to reconstruct the reciprocal space. These powerful tools are built for tackling the most challenging samples (modulated, twinned samples, intergrown crystals, texture, … or whatever is waiting in reciprocal space) and are extraordinarily efficient teaching tools.
Reciprocal Lattice Viewer
The Reciprocal lattice viewer is an interactive tool to visualize and align complex reflection patterns.
- Routines for graphical unit cell determination and layer display
- Display and interactively modify a reflection array
- Remove artifacts from strong amorphous scatterers
- Visually separate twin components
- Determine q-vectors of modulated samples
Pseudo Precession Photograph
The Pseudo precession photograph tool provides an undistorted view of layers in the reciprocal space.
- Reconstruct Pseudo precession photographs pixel by pixel
- Visualize Laue-class symmetry
- Verify systematic absences
- Visualize Thermal diffuse scattering
- Select layers using non-integers
Diffraction Space Viewer
The concept of the Pseudo precession photograph tool is expanded to the three dimensional space.
- Display the complete reciprocal space as a volume
- Investigate textured samples, fibers and non-Bragg diffraction
- Free rotation of the 3-D space including zoom, and display of slices
